Accessible Manufacturing Equipment Phase 2 Team 2 Nicholas Neumann Ralph Prewett Jonathan Brouker Felix Adisaputra Li Tian December 10 th, 2010 ECE 480.

Slides:



Advertisements
Similar presentations
1 ECE 372 – Microcontroller Design Parallel IO Ports - Outputs Parallel IO Ports E.g. Port T, Port AD Used to interface with many devices Switches LEDs.
Advertisements

LabView Basics.
SUN TRACKING SOLAR PANEL. Introduction The main objective of this project is to track the sun and rotate the solar panel accordingly, to receive sunlight.
Accessible Manufacturing Equipment Phase 2 Proposal Team 2 Nicholas Neumann Ralph Prewett Jonathan Brouker Li Tian Felix Adisaputra.
Data Acquisition Risanuri Hidayat.
EE 472 – Senior Project Hang B. Lee, Applied Physics & EE Advisor: Prof. Robert Grober “Noise Characterization of A/D Converter on PIC Microcontroller”
16/13/2015 3:30 AM6/13/2015 3:30 AM6/13/2015 3:30 AMIntroduction to Software Development What is a computer? A computer system contains: Central Processing.
Design and Implementation of a Virtual Reality Glove Device Final presentation – winter 2001/2 By:Amos Mosseri, Shy Shalom, Instructors:Michael.
1 Color Discriminating Tracking System Lloyd Rochester Sam Duncan Ben Schulz Fernando Valentiner.
R I T Team Members: Nandini Vemuri → Team Lead, System Testing, Motor Expert Jason Jack → GUI Design, Microcontroller Expert, Website Administrator John.
Microprogrammes control the KOMBIS TMM8003. For the reliable operation of its systems and devices there are several programs located in two controllers.
Liter Liquid Tending Robot Julie Lam Kevin Chang Jason Smith Andrew Jenkins.
Damian Marks Rekha Vemuri Instructor: Dr. Wu Simple control system for a Stepper and DC motor using a tachometer and the HC11.
Automated Precision Machines Team 2 Nicholas Neumann Ralph Prewett Jonathan Brouker Li Tian Felix Adisaputra November 5 th, 2010.
Spectrum Analyzer Ray Mathes, Nirav Patel,
Digital I/O Connecting to the Outside World
Introduction.
Kinetix 3 Component Servo Drive
Engineering 1040: Mechanisms & Electric Circuits Fall 2011 Introduction to Embedded Systems.
Embedded Systems Design
Edited by Mandar More Technical Manager, Ninad`s Research lab Ninad243.weebly.com MODERN OFFICE MANAGEMENT TOOL FOR SELECTIVE DATA.
2 Lines Electronics I 2 C Analyzer Ching-Yen Beh Robert S. Stookey Advisor: Dr. J. W. Bruce.
To control the movement of a manual wheelchair by means of human voice for paralyzed patients. AIM:
PIC Evaluation/ Development Board Dec02-12 December 10, 2002 Client: ECpE Department Faculty Advisors: Dr. Rover, Dr. Weber Chad Berg, Luke Bishop, Tyson.
Jordan Wagner Justin Spencer Mark Sears John Jachna.
Prepared By: Rania hasan Enas hamadneh Cnc machine.
EMERGENCY VEHICLE ALERT SYSTEM ECE 495C Digital Systems Senior Design Project Proposal Team #3 Spring 2008 January 09, 2008.
Group 8: Video Game Console Team Members: Rich Capone Hong Jin Cho Dave Elliott Ryan Gates.
HARDWARE INTERFACE FOR A 3-DOF SURGICAL ROBOT ARM Ahmet Atasoy 1, Mehmed Ozkan 2, Duygun Erol Barkana 3 1 Institute of Biomedical Engineering, Bogazici.
Overview What is Arduino? What is it used for? How to get started Demonstration Questions are welcome at any time.
YIZUMI H Series Die Casting Machine Alshen
Representing Numerical Data Analog Any signal that varies continuously over time Mechanical Pneumatic Hydraulic Electrical Digital Quantities are represented.
Senior Design Project “ MP3 Player ” Brian P. Allen Zeeshan A. Khan Jerry T. Koshy.
Audioprocessor for Automobiles Using the TMS320C50 DSP Ted Subonj Presentation on SPRA302 CSE671 / Dr. S. Ganesan.
ECE 477 Senior Design Group 12  Spring 2006 Daniel da Silva Atandra Burman Eric Aasen Harsha Vangapaty.
RTLS. LOCATING / POSITIONING SYSTEMS A positioning system is a mechanism for determining the location of an object in space Interplanetary systems Global.
Emergency Vehicle Detector for use in Consumer’s Motor Vehicle Georgia Institute of Technology School of Electrical and Computer Engineering ECE 4007 Ehren.
T BAC Speaker Name Slide 1 Earl Grey and The Boston Tea Party Present The Entourage.
Final Year Project(EPT4046) Development of an internet controlled Surveillance Mobile Robot By Mimi Madihah Bt Mohd Idris Id: BACHELOR OF ENGINEERING.
Closed Loop Temperature Control Circuit with LCD Display Mike Wooldridge ECE 4330 Embedded Systems.
Submitted by:.  Project overview  Block diagram  Power supply  Microcontroller  MAX232 & DB9 Connector  Relay  Relay driver  Software requirements.
BLDC Motor Speed Control with RPM Display. Introduction BLDC Motor Speed Control with RPM Display  The main objective of this.
MICROCONTROLLER INTERFACING WITH STEPPER MOTOR MADE BY: Pruthvirajsinh Jadeja ( ) COLLEGE:DIET BRANCH:EC.
Arduino Based DC Motor Speed Control
Logic Circuit Teaching Board Team 3 David Lee, Younas Abdul Salam, Andrzej Borzecki ECE 445 Senior Design TA: Ankit Jain Date: April 27, 2015.
DIGITAL SHOWER CONTROLLER BY NATHAN GARNER KASUN KUMARAGE.
SUBMITTED BY EDGEFX TEAM PORTABLE CODED WIRELESS MESSAGE COMMUNICATION BETWEEN TWO PARTIES SECRETLY WITH LCD DISPLAY.
Deep Touch Pressure Abdomen Belt Group 32 Kevin Rathbun & Luke Fleming & Chang-O Pyo ECE 445 Senior Design April 28, 2015.
Power Budget Automation System Team #40 Hai Vo, Ho Chuen Tsang, Vi Tran ECE 445 Senior Design April 30 st, 2013.
1. PIC ADC  PIC18F877 has 8 analog input channels i.e. port A pins(RA0 to RA5) and port E pins(RE1 and RE2). These pins are used as Analog input pins.
SUBMITTED BY EDGEFX TEAM
Arduino based Automatic Temperature Controlled Fan Speed Regulator.
LOGO AutoCarParking Capstone Project. LOGO Project Role HungPD Supervisor Huynb Project Manager, Developer Truongpx Developer Tuanhh Developer, tester.
Components of Mechatronic Systems AUE 425 Week 2 Kerem ALTUN October 3, 2016.
CNC FEED DRIVES.
SNS COLLEGE OF ENGINEERING
ARDUINO BASED UNDERGROUND CABLE FAULT DETECTION
Scrolling LCD using Arduino.
SUBMITTED BY EDGEFX TEAM
Arduino Based Industrial appliances control system by decoding dual tone multi frequency signals on GSM / CDMA network. Submitted by:
SCADA for Remote Industrial Plant
COMPUTER ORGANIZATION & ASSEMBLY LANGUAGE
PC Mouse operated Electrical Load Control Using VB Application
Project Title EVM IN PIC Under the Guidance of Submitted by.
NC,CNC machines and Control Programming.
NC and CNC machines and Control Programming
Introduction to Software Planning and Design
ACOE347 – Data Acquisition and Automation Systems
Cnc machine Presented By:.
Presentation transcript:

Accessible Manufacturing Equipment Phase 2 Team 2 Nicholas Neumann Ralph Prewett Jonathan Brouker Felix Adisaputra Li Tian December 10 th, 2010 ECE 480 Senior Capstone Design

Contents  Background  Design Specifications  Final Design  Results and Evaluations  Conclusion  Future Improvements  Demonstration

Background  Basic Purpose of the Project  Former 2008 Machine

Background  Former 2008 Machine (Continued)  PIC Programming C Code Timing Loop  Stepper Motors Parallel Operation (Belt)  Cam Motors  Rotary Cutter  Stationary and Movable Clamps

Background  Major Problems  Programming Interface No C programmers on staff at location Difficult Maintenance  Stepper Motors Inaccuracy Slow Operation  Motor Drivers Overheat Issue

Design Specifications  Critical Customer Requirements  Simple Programming Language Easy Maintenance  High Level of Accuracy Different Types of Motor  Variable Speed Control Higher Maximum Speed of Operation

Design Specifications  Secondary Objectives  Visual and Audio Feedback  Reliability and Robustness Reduce Occurrence of Jamming  Safety Better Design of Safety Guards  Reduce Noise During Operation  Compact Machine  Aesthetics

Final Design  Mechanical Systems  Pneumatic Guillotine Cutter  Valves Assembly

Final Design  Mechanical Systems (Continued)  Two Capstans Design Increases the Speed of Operation

Final Design  Mechanical Systems (Continued)  Adjustable Frame

Final Design  Mechanical Systems (Continued)  Tracking Guard

Final Design  Hardware  LEGO NXT Brick as Microcontroller LCD Screen for Speed Display Limited I/O Ports  LEGO Servo Motors High Accuracy Compatibility  I 2 C Serial Communication Bus I/O Expander PCF8574

Final Design  Hardware (Continued)  Input (Buttons)  8-Segment LED Display Length Output

Final Design  Hardware (Continued)  Cutter Relay Control Power Transistor  LEGO NXT Brick Power Supply Step-Down Converter Circuit –LM7809 Voltage Regulator

Final Design  Software  LEGO Mindstorms NXT-G Time

Final Design Accepts User Input. Executes Commands Starts or Stops Cutting Process Contains Cutting Process Drives 8 Segment Display Displays Length and Speed on NXT Display

Results and Evaluations  Improved Accuracy  2008: 13.24% defects  2010: 1.46% defects  Reduced Percentage Error  2008: %  2010: 2.7%

Results and Evaluations  Enhanced Speed of Operation  For 100 Cycle Run: 2008: 7 min 49.7sec 2010: 2 min 27sec  3.19 Times Faster

Results and Evaluations  Capstan Feed Design  Removed Drift Factor  Smaller Size of the Machine  4.7 Times Smaller in Area  LEGO Servo Motors  Eliminated Overheating Issue  Sources of Error  Susceptible to Ribbon Feed Method Ribbon at Similar Elevation Improves Accuracy Significantly

Conclusion  Accomplishments  Maintain Simplicity of the Programming LEGO Mindstorms NXT-G  Better Accuracy and Consistency LEGO Servo Motors  Variable Speed Controller Implementation Higher Maximum Speed of Operation

Conclusion  Accomplishments (Continued)  LED Display and Speaker  Reliable and Robust Tracking Guards Prevent Jamming  Better Safety Safety Guards  Less Noise  Smaller Size  Aesthetics

Cost PartNumberCost Guillotine Knife1$ IC LED Driver1$2.80 LED Display1$ digit LED Driver with I2C Bus interface1$3.20 LED driver w/I2C1$ uF Capacitor1$0.83 A Voltage Regulator1$0.70 I2C interface 8 bit I/O Expander2$3.32 IC I/O Expander5$9.30 Tubing1$18.75 Valve1$19.75 Filter1$11.25 Regulator1$17.00 Pneumatic Lubricator1$12.25 Male Straight1/4NPT*1/4 inch1$4.50 Male Straight1/8NPT*1/4 inch2$5.00 Male Elbow1/8NPT*1/4 inch2$12.00 Shipping $32.64 *Lego Mindstorms NXT 2.01$ Total Cost: $ *Sponsored by Sponsor

Future Improvements Warning Message Detects Jam Number Pad Length Speed Faster More Range

Future Improvements  Audio (ISD 1400)  Louder  Adjustable Volume Control A4A5A6A

Demonstration

Questions